**Ingredients and Preparation**

To create this dish, you’ll need the following ingredients:

– Noodles: Choose your favorite type, such as soba, udon, or even spaghetti.
– Citron: Fresh citron zest and juice add a bright, citrusy note.
– Miso: White miso paste is preferred for its mild, sweet flavor.
– Garlic: Fresh cloves, minced, to infuse the butter with aromatic depth.
– Butter: Unsalted, to control the saltiness of the dish.
– Optional: Fresh herbs like parsley or cilantro for garnish.

**Cooking Instructions**

1. **Prepare the Noodles:** Cook the noodles according to the package instructions. Once cooked, drain and set aside.

2. **Make the Sauce:** In a large pan, melt the butter over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sauté until fragrant, being careful not to burn it. Stir in the miso paste until it’s fully incorporated into the butter.

3. **Add Citron:** Zest the citron directly into the pan, then squeeze in the juice. Stir well to combine all the flavors.

4. **Combine and Serve:** Add the cooked noodles to the pan, tossing them gently to coat them evenly with the sauce. If the sauce is too thick, a splash of the reserved noodle cooking water can help achieve the desired consistency.

5. **Garnish and Enjoy:** Serve the noodles hot, garnished with fresh herbs if desired. The dish pairs well with a simple green salad or steamed vegetables.

#### Ingredients
To create Simple One-Pot Taco Macaroni, you will require these ingredients:

– **1 pound ground beef or turkey**: A lean protein source that serves as the foundation of the meal.
– **1 cup elbow macaroni**: The traditional pasta type that absorbs the dish’s flavors.
– **1 can (15 oz) black beans**: Rinsed and drained, these contribute fiber and extra protein.
– **1 can (10 oz) diced tomatoes with green chilies**: Adds extra taste and a hint of heat.
– **2 cups beef or vegetable broth**: To cook the pasta and elevate the overall flavor.
– **1 packet taco seasoning**: A spice blend that imparts the dish with its distinctive taco taste.
– **1 cup shredded cheese**: Cheddar or a Mexican blend works wonderfully for a creamy texture.
– **Optional toppings**: Sour cream, chopped cilantro, diced avocado, or sliced jalapeños.

#### Preparation Steps
1. **Brown the Meat**: In a large pot or Dutch oven, cook the ground beef or turkey over medium heat until browned. Drain any excess fat if needed.

2. **Incorporate Ingredients**: Stir in the taco seasoning, black beans, diced tomatoes, elbow macaroni, and broth. Mix thoroughly to combine all ingredients.

3. **Cook the Pasta**: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over and let it simmer for about 10-12 minutes, or until the pasta is cooked al dente and most of the liquid is absorbed.

4. **Incorporate Cheese**: Remove the pot from the heat and mix in the shredded cheese until it melts and becomes creamy. If desired, adjust seasoning according to your taste.

5. **Serve**: Serve the Taco Macaroni into bowls and garnish with your preferred optional toppings.

### High-Protein, High-Fiber Comforting Tuscan White Bean Soup with Meatballs

#### Introduction
Tuscan gastronomy is celebrated for its robust and soothing meals, and a high-protein, high-fiber Tuscan white bean soup with meatballs exemplifies this perfectly. This dish merges the rich texture of white beans with the delectable taste of meatballs, resulting in a nourishing meal that is both fulfilling and healthful.

#### Ingredients
– **For the Soup:**
– 2 cups canned or prepared white beans (like cannellini or great northern)
– 1 medium on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 2 carrots, chopped
– 2 celery stalks, chopped
– 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
– 4 cups low-sodium vegetable or chicken broth
– 1 teaspoon dried thyme
– 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
– 1 bay leaf
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 2 cups kale or spinach, chopped
– 2 tablespoons olive oil

– **For the Meatballs:**
– 1 pound ground turkey or chicken (for a leaner alternative)
– 1/2 cup breadcrumbs (whole grain for extra fiber)
– 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 1 egg
– 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
– 1 teaspoon garlic powder
– Salt and pepper to taste

#### Preparation

1. **Prepare the Meatballs:**
– In a large mixing bowl, combine ground turkey or chicken, bre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, egg, parsley,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
– Blend until just mixed. Shape the mixture into small meatballs, around 1 inch in diameter.
– In a large skillet, warm a t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at. Cook the meatballs until browned all over, roughly 5-7 minutes. Remove and set them aside.

2. **Cook the Soup:**
– In a large pot, heat the remaining t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at. Add in the diced onion, carrots, and celery, and sauté until tender, about 5-7 minutes.
–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an extra minute until aromatic.
– Incorporate the diced tomatoes, white beans, broth, thyme, rosemary, bay leaf, salt, and pepper. Bring to a boil, then lower the heat and let it simmer for about 15 minutes.
– Add the chopped kale or spinach and the browned meatballs to the pot. Continue to simmer for another 10-15 minutes until the meatballs are fully cooked and the greens are soft.

3. **Serve:**
– Remove the bay leaf before serving. Ladle the soup into bowls and embellish with extra Parmesan cheese and fresh parsley if desired.

### Chick-fil-A Inspired Egg White Grill Recipe

Chick-fil-A’s Egg White Grill is a favorite breakfast choice that merges the health benefits of egg whites with grilled chicken, all served atop a toasted English muffin. This recipe seeks to recreate that delightful experience in your kitchen, offering a healthier option that is simple to prepare and full of flavor.

#### Ingredients

**For the Egg White Grill:**
– 1 whole wheat English muffin
– 1 large egg white (or 2 for a more substantial sandwich)
– 1 slice of grilled chicken breast (approximately 3-4 ounces)
– 1 slice of reduced-fat cheddar cheese
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Cooking spray or a small drizzle of olive oil

**For the Marinade (optional for chicken):**
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– 1 teaspoon lemon juice
– 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
– 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
– Salt and pepper to taste

#### Instructions

1. **Prepare the Chicken:**
– If you’re using raw chicken breast, marinate it in a blend of olive oil, lemon juice,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per for a minimum of 30 minutes. This will enhance the chicken’s flavor and tenderness.
– Grill the chicken breast over medium heat for roughly 6-7 minutes per side or until fully cooked. Allow it to rest for a few minutes before slicing.

2. **Cook the Egg Whites:**
– In a non-stick skillet, apply a light layer of cooking spray or add a small amount of olive oil. Warm the skillet over medium-low heat.
– Pour in the egg whites and season with salt and pepper. Cook until the egg whites are set, about 2-3 minutes. You may gently flip them for even cooking if you wish.

3. **Assemble the Sandwich:**
– Toast the whole wheat English muffin until it’s golden brown.
– Position the grilled chicken breast on the bottom half of the muffin.
– Add the cooked egg whites on top of the chicken.
– Place the slice of reduced-fat cheddar cheese over the egg whites.
– Cap it with the other half of the English muffin.

4. **Serve:**
– Serve right away while it’s warm. This sandwich goes well with a side of fresh fruit or a small serving of yogurt for a complete breakfast.

#### Nutritional Information (per serving)

– Calories: Approximately 300
– Protein: 30g
– Carbohydrates: 30g
– Fat: 8g
– Fiber: 5g

**Vegan Mexican Hominy Stew (Red Pozole): A Flavorful Plant-Based Delight**

Pozole, a traditional Mexican stew, is a beloved dish known for its rich flavors and hearty ingredients. Traditionally made with pork or chicken, this classic dish has been reimagined in a vegan version that retains all the deliciousness while catering to plant-based diets. Vegan Mexican Hominy Stew, or Red Pozole, offers a vibrant and satisfying meal that is both nourishing and full of authentic Mexican flavors.

**Ingredients and Preparation**

The key ingredient in pozole is hominy, which is dried corn kernels that have been treated with an alkali in a process called nixtamalization. This gives hominy its unique texture and flavor, making it an essential component of the stew. For the vegan version, the richness typically provided by meat is replaced with a variety of vegetables and spices, creating a complex and savory broth.

To prepare Vegan Red Pozole, start by gathering the following ingredients:

– 2 cups of canned or cooked hominy
– 1 large onion, diced
– 3 cloves of garlic, minced
– 2 tablespoons of vegetable oil
– 2 teaspoons of ground cumin
– 2 teaspoons of dried oregano
– 1 teaspoon of smoked paprika
– 3 dried guajillo chilies, stemmed and seeded
– 1 dried ancho chili, stemmed and seeded
– 6 cups of vegetable broth
– 1 can (14 oz) of diced tomatoes
– 1 zucchini, diced
– 1 cup of sliced mushrooms
– Salt and pepper to taste

**Instructions**

1. **Prepare the Chilies**: Begin by soaking the dried guajillo and ancho chilies in hot water for about 15 minutes until they are softened. Once softened, blend them with a little soaking water until smooth, creating a rich chili paste.

2. **Sauté the Aromatics**: In a large pot, heat the vegetable o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ion and minced garlic, sautéing until the onion becomes translucent.

3. **Build the Flavor Base**: Stir in the ground cumin, dried oregano, and smoked paprika, allowing the spices to toast slightly and release their aromas.

4. **Add the Broth and Tomatoes**: Pour in the vegetable broth and diced tomatoes, bringing the mixture to a gentle simmer.

5. **Incorporate the Chili Paste**: Stir in the prepared chili paste, ensuring it is well combined with the broth. This will give the stew its characteristic red color and depth of flavor.

6. **Simmer the Stew**: Add the hominy, zucchini, and mushrooms to the pot.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Allow the stew to simmer for about 30 minutes, letting the flavors meld together.

**Serving Suggestions**

Vegan Red Pozole is traditionally garnished with a variety of fresh toppings that add texture and brightness to the dish. Consider serving it with:

– Shredded cabbage or lettuce
– Sliced radishes
– Chopped cilantro
– Diced avocado
– Lime wedges
– Tortilla chips or tostadas

These garnishes not only enhance the presentation but also provide a refreshing contrast to the rich and spicy stew.

### Whipped Ricotta Dip: A Fresh Spin on Traditional Caprese Flavors

The traditional Caprese salad, boasting a lively mix of fresh mozzarella, juicy tomatoes, basil, olive oil, and balsamic vinegar, has been a cornerstone of Italian cooking for ages. Nevertheless, as culinary innovation thrives, new renditions of this cherished dish are surfacing. One such creation is the whipped ricotta dip, which encapsulates the spirit of Caprese flavors while presenting a distinct and enjoyable twist.

#### Ingredients and Preparation

To whip up a ricotta dip, the key ingredient is ricotta cheese, naturally. This rich cheese forms the foundation, providing a light and fluffy texture when whipped. The following components are generally included to elevate the dip:

– **Fresh Ricotta Cheese**: The highlight of the dish, ricotta brings creaminess and a gentle flavor.
– **Fresh Basil**: Minced basil imparts the dip with the fragrant essence of Caprese.
– **Cherry Tomatoes**: Halved or quartered, these contribute sweetness and a burst of color.
– **Extra Virgin Olive Oil**: A splash of premium olive oil deepens richness and flavor.
– **Balsamic Glaze**: This provides a zesty sweetness that enhances the other ingredients.
– **Salt and Pepper**: Crucial for seasoning and enhancing the overall flavor profile.

To prepare the dip, simply blend the ricotta cheese, a drizzle of olive oil, salt, and pepper in a food processor until smooth and creamy. Next, gently fold in the chopped basil for a fresh flavor boost. Serve the dip in a bowl, garnished with cherry tomatoes and a drizzle of balsamic glaze for an appealing presentation.

#### Serving Suggestions

Whipped ricotta dip is wonderfully adaptable and can be enjoyed in various ways:

– **As a Dip**: Combine it with a variety of dippers such as crusty bread, pita chips, or vegetable sticks for a delightful starter.
– **On Crostini**: Spread the whipped ricotta over toasted baguette slices and top with cherry tomatoes and basil for a sophisticated appetizer.
– **As a Salad Base**: Use the dip as a foundation for a salad, layering it with sliced tomatoes, fresh mozzarella, and basil for a deconstructed Caprese experience.
– **With Grilled Meats**: Serve alongside grilled chicken or fish to incorporate a creamy, flavorful element to the meal.
